Recipe here: www.joyofbakin... Stephanie Jaworski of Joyofbaking.com demonstrates how to make Peppermint Patties.
Peppermint Patties are the perfect confection. Perfect because they have a delicious coating of shiny dark chocolate. And perfect because the filling is so soft and creamy, with a peppermint flavor that gives a nice blast of 'cool' that tingles the mouth.

I am a chocolatier, and this is the best recipe I know of to make peppermint patties. I actually place them inside polycarbonate disc molds for a clean, professional look. I decorate the transfer sheets before putting the chocolate in the molds. This year I made them vegan and they are fantastic! I used coconut cream instead of cream, and Miyoko vegan butter instead of regular butter. I use the salted butter, because normally I would put a tiny pinch of finally ground sea salt in them anyway. It has a very slight, fresh coconut smell, but you cannot really taste the difference. They are just so good! Thank you so much for this recipe!

Hi Jonathan, be careful substituting essential oils for food-grade extracts and oils. Essential oils are not safety regulated by the FDA and ingesting them is not recommended. (yes, even doTerra, despite what the company says) Ingesting essential oils can be harmful in the long term, or even short-term if you use the wrong one. They're great for aromatherapy and for topical use when diluted with a carrier oil, but they're much too concentrated to be safe for internal use. Best of luck!
